Riccio Restaurant
About
Riccio Restaurant is a lively seaside eatery located in the picturesque Porto di Baia in Bacoli, Campania. The menu is a celebration of Mediterranean flavors and local ingredients, featuring fresh seafood, ceviche, and cured fish products crafted by chefs Agostino Alboretto and Roberta Di Meo. The atmosphere blends a historic maritime vibe with modern comforts: a heated terrace with sea views, outdoor seating, free Wi‑Fi, and table service that welcomes a relaxed dining experience. Guests begin with a signature “Crudi di Mare” platter, a showcase of raw seafood that sets the tone for the meal, followed by the “Salumi di Mare” – cured fish served with a selection of sparkling wines chosen by the kitchen. All dishes are prepared from ingredients sourced daily from the local ports and the fertile Flegrea fields, ensuring freshness and authenticity.
